Learn more about EPS files

An EPS (Encapsulated PostScript) file is a graphics file format that is commonly used in the printing and publishing industries. It is a vector-based file format that contains both text and graphics information. EPS files are created using Adobe Illustrator and other similar software applications. One of the key advantages of EPS files is their ability to maintain high-quality resolution when scaled or resized. This makes EPS files ideal for printing purposes, as they can be easily resized without sacrificing image quality. EPS files are also commonly used for creating logos, illustrations, and other types of artwork. They are compatible with both PC and Mac operating systems, making them a versatile file format for a wide range of users. Overall, EPS files are an efficient and widely-used graphics file format that is essential for any professional printing or publishing project.

Learn more about DNG files

A DNG file, also known as a Digital Negative file, is a type of raw image file format that was developed by Adobe Systems. It is used for archiving and distributing raw files captured by digital cameras. DNG files are essentially unprocessed image files that contain all the image data captured by the camera's sensor, allowing photographers to have complete control over the final image during post-processing. Unlike proprietary raw file formats, DNG files are open source and can be readily accessed by different software applications and platforms. They offer a more universal solution for photographers who want to preserve their raw image data and ensure long-term compatibility across different devices and software.
